Switzerland - Child Mortality Rate

Since 2014, Switzerland Child Mortality Rate was down by 3.7% year on year. In 2019, the country was number 188 comparing other countries in Child Mortality Rate at 0.63 Units (Deaths) Per Thousand Children Aged 5-14. Switzerland is overtaken by Finland, which was ranked number 187 at 0.65 Units (Deaths) Per Thousand Children Aged 5-14 and is followed by San Marino with 0.61 Units (Deaths) Per Thousand Children Aged 5-14. Niger ranked the highest with 36.53 Units (Deaths) Per Thousand Children Aged 5-14 in 2019, that is a fall of 2.1% compared to 2018. Cameroon, Democratic Republic of the Congo and Chad resp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Grenada recorded the best 5 years average growth at +1.7% per year, while Sri Lanka witnessed the worst performance at -12.3% per year.
